Why Sustainable Agriculture Is Important?
It’s hard to imagine where humanity would be without agriculture. Thousands of years ago, global populations grew rapidly as the practice of agriculture spread across the world. At the same time, nomadic lifestyles fell out of favor and humans found greater autonomy. The concept of civilization as we know it wouldn’t be possible without the advent of agriculture, and it remains a crucial aspect of modern life.

Upcoming Trends in Machine Automation
In the early 1950s, Alan Turing anticipated the future of artificial intelligence and articulated his concerns in a paper called Intelligent Machinery, A Heretical Theory. It was in this paper that he predicted the eventual advancement of artificial intelligence (AI) to a point that machines would overtake humans as the decision-makers of our world.
